Set amidst lush greenery, this monumental former industrial building from the early 20th century offers an exceptional 2,000 m² of space on a 2,800 m² lot. This unique site is a former power station of the Société des Mines de la Houve, a testament to the railway and border history of the Saulnois region. It houses a 273 m² loft on the second floor, featuring a commanding suspended terrace and a 180° view of the surrounding countryside. Combining the charm of a contemporary renovation with the precision of metal structures, this living space offers spectacular volumes and abundant natural light, complemented by a wellness area currently under development. Upon entering the loft, one discovers a vast, bright reception area and an open kitchen where the metal framework highlights the high ceilings. A central fireplace warms this open space, which opens directly onto the outdoors. Perched ten meters above the ground, the suspended terrace offers a spectacular panorama where the eye takes in the bucolic horizon of the Saulnois region from a striking aerial perspective. The sleeping area consists of five spacious bedrooms, a separate walk-in closet, and two bathrooms. Access to the top floor reveals exceptional potential for conversion under a roof reaching 7 meters in height, while the first floor offers an unfinished space ideal for creating brutalist-style lofts or artist studios. The ground floor, currently used as a warehouse, perfectly meets the needs of a craftsman or collector. The landscaped garden, featuring greenhouses, is a true haven of serenity. Several outdoor parking spaces and the possibility of creating a multi-vehicle garage facilitate the daily use of this property. Although access is currently via stairs, a shaft is already in place for the installation of an elevator serving all levels. Located just 5 minutes from the schools and amenities of Château-Salins, the estate allows you to reach the Porte Verte commercial district in Essey-lès-Nancy in 20 minutes. This industrial cathedral, once a symbol of modernity in the border region, represents a rare opportunity for enthusiasts of bold renovations and lifestyle projects that blend private and professional spheres. A visit is essential to fully appreciate the grandeur and charm of this historic site. Nestling in the heart of a charming village near Courcelles-Chaussy, this 10-acre property, originally farm buildings, was carefully renovated ten years ago. Transformed into two independent dwellings, it spans a total surface area of 440 m². The renovation has successfully enhanced the original architectural features while incorporating contemporary materials, giving the property an authentic, refined character. The main house, with a floor surface area of approx. 260 m², features a vast living room on the ground floor with impressive high ceilings, bathed in light thanks to the skylight installed in place of the old barn door and several French windows offering direct access to the garden. This space is warmed by a remarkable tiled stove. Connected to the living room, the contemporary kitchen has a central island where you can enjoy a meal together. This level also includes a bedroom with en suite shower room, a further room that could be used as a study, a utility room and a storage room. Upstairs, an elegant staircase combining stainless steel and glass leads to a sleeping area comprising a bathroom, four bedrooms and a master suite with en suite shower room. The second house, converted from an old stable, is now used as a guest house. The entrance hall opens onto a cosy reception room with an open-plan kitchen and tiled stove. The old troughs, perfectly restored, add an extra touch of originality. Upstairs are 4 uniquely decorated bedrooms, each with its own shower room. At the rear of the property, the overgrown garden features shaded terraces and a refreshing swimming pool, creating the ideal setting in which to recharge your batteries. A small additional plot is also available for sale, allowing this beautiful exterior to be personalised even further. This character property is offered for sale as a whole or in two separate units, depending on individual requirements. The bed and breakfast business, which has been running for around ten years, currently generates annual sales of around euros45,000. Renovated using quality materials that combine traditional features with modern finishes, this property offers a high level of energy comfort. It is ideal for a family looking for a spacious place to live in the countryside, or for an investor looking to develop a hotel business in an enchanting setting.
